WebMRI scans use radio waves and magnetic fields to create detailed images of the inside of the body, including the interior components of the ear. An MRI scan may reveal a growth on the nerve pathway that connects the ear to the brain, such as an acoustic neuroma. These growths can prevent the ear from functioning well and may cause hearing loss.

WebFeb 7, 2024 · The middle ear or middle ear cavity, also known as tympanic cavity or tympanum (plural: tympanums/tympana), is an air-filled chamber in the petrous part of the temporal bone . It is separated from the external ear by the tympanic membrane, and from the inner ear by the medial wall of the tympanic cavity. Ear tumors can form on the outer ear (skin cancer), inner ear (acoustic neuroma) or middle ear (glomus tympanicum). Most ear tumors are benign (not cancerous), but they may cause hearing loss. …
